SystemLinkインストーラーが JupyterHubパッケージでエラー 1で失敗する

更新しました Dec 9, 2025

使用製品

ソフトウェア

  • SystemLink Server
  • SystemLink

問題

SystemLinkインストーラを実行すると、JupyterHubパッケージで失敗し、「エラー 1 」が返されます。 JupyterHubコンポーネントの選択を解除すると、他のすべてのコンポーネントは問題なくインストールされます。

解決策

これは、「$」文字で始まるユーザー名でログインしている場合に発生します。この場合、考えられる回避策は2つあります。

  • 「$」文字で始まらないユーザー名でログインし、インストーラを再実行できます。
  • 特定の Windows 環境変数を作成し、インストーラを再実行できます。たとえば、Windows ユーザーが「$myuser」の場合、次の操作を行う必要があります。
  1. 「myuser」という名前の環境変数を作成します。
  2. その変数の値を「$myuser」に設定します。
環境変数.png
 

追加情報

JupyterHubインストーラはPythonコードを実行し、また「 pip 」コマンドを動的に実行してモジュールをインストールします。 「 pip 」コマンドは、「$myuser」を「myuser」という名前のWindows環境変数への参照として解釈します。このような「myuser」Windows環境変数を値「$myuser」で作成すると、pipコマンドは「$myuser」を正しく解決します。